Researchers detailed two Safari WebKit exploitation paths that turned renderer memory corruption into reliable arbitrary read/write primitives on macOS and iOS. Google Project Zero showed how CVE-2020-9802, a JavaScriptCore JIT flaw, could be exploited starting from addrof and fakeobj primitives, then bypass WebKit mitigations including StructureID randomization, the Gigacage, and PACCage. The write-up demonstrated leaking a valid StructureID with a fake JSArray and then abusing TypedArray handling in the DFG JIT to escape the Gigacage and gain fast, stable arbitrary memory access.
Theori separately analyzed a Safari AudioWorklet type confusion introduced in Safari 14.1, where WebKit failed to verify that a returned JavaScript object was a JSAudioWorkletProcessor. That missing type check allowed attacker-controlled objects to be confused and used to corrupt JSArray butterfly pointers, again yielding addrof, fakeobj, and arbitrary read/write capabilities. The exploit reportedly worked on iOS 14.6 and macOS 11.4 even after the source patch was public, highlighting patch-gap risk and reinforcing concerns that existing WebKit hardening measures could still be bypassed in practice.

Theori published an analysis of a Safari AudioWorklet type confusion vulnerability in WebKit, explaining that the bug was introduced with Safari 14.1 and that a missing jsDynamicCast check enabled memory corruption and exploitation. The write-up said the exploit remained reachable on iOS releases after the patch became public and reportedly worked on iOS 14.6 and macOS 11.4.
Google Project Zero published the second part of its JITSploitation series, detailing how to turn a JavaScriptCore JIT bug tracked as CVE-2020-9802 into stable arbitrary memory read/write in Safari despite mitigations such as StructureID randomization, the Gigacage, and the PACCage.
